Benefits Of Drinking Dragon Well Tea & Long Jing Tea

by Charles Hegedorn on January 27, 2012

Inexperienced teas have long been high on the listing of beverages that may have useful results on the well being of those who drink them. The distinction between green tea and black tea (the type most often drunk in western countries) is within the process that is used to provide it; green tea is steamed, somewhat than dried and fermented (as with black and oolong teas), so that there is a lot much less oxidation, resulting within the fresher, greener color.

There are lots of kinds of inexperienced tea out there; these include Long Jing tea (the title means Dragon Properly Tea), Gunpowder tea, Jasmine Pearl tea, and Matcha (a Japanese model), in addition to many others.

The benefits linked with inexperienced teas are many and varied, including weight reduction, pores and skin readability, tooth and gum health, lower ldl cholesterol, and even cancer prevention. So how is inexperienced tea thought to assist in all these areas?

The main benefit of inexperienced tea, including Lengthy Jing tea, or Dragon Nicely tea, in addition to the others talked about above, is that it accommodates excessive levels of anti-oxidants. These are known to assist fight the dangerous free radicals that can kind within the physique and cause damage to cells. It’s this impact that’s thought to help with inhibiting the growth of most cancers cells, and killing cancer cells with out adversely affecting wholesome ones. Anti-oxidants are also believed to be helpful within the prevention of thrombosis, or formation of abnormal blood clots, which is a serious explanation for stroke and coronary heart attack.

In skin care, topical utility of green tea is said to assist with each pimples and eczema. It’s also stated that drinking inexperienced tea can be efficient in preventing zits, though in some people the presence of caffeine could also be a set off inducing breakouts.

Using green tea as an ingredient in mouthwash might assist prevent tooth decay and strengthen tooth and gums, because of the presence of fluoride.

And, though simply drinking green tea has not yet been proven to assist with weight loss, green tea extracts are utilized in several commercially out there products, which appear to extend metabolic rates without growing heart rates. It’s additionally this that is thought to decrease cholesterol levels.

Probably the most well-known and popular among inexperienced teas is Long Jing Tea, often known as Dragon Effectively tea, which is traditionally grown in Zhejiang province, but additionally produced in many different areas. Since all green teas, and black teas, are made from the same species of plant (Camellia sinensis), there’s little to be concerned about by way of the actual provenance of the leaves; Lengthy Jing tea will get its distinctive, flat-leafed look from the pan-firing process utilized in its production. The actual attraction of Lengthy Jing, or Dragon Nicely tea, is its recent, crisp, and fruity taste, and it has a pale golden color that makes it very enticing when served. The Tea Culture Of China

by Charles Hegedorn on January 27, 2012

Have you ever ever wondered why so much attention is paid to tea ceremonies within the East? If in case you have ever traveled to both China or Japan, then you haven’t any doubt encountered the cultural phenomena of tea drinking. China is the origin for the tea drinking cultures of most of East Asia. It is among the oldest and longest enduring practices which most of these cultures have in common. When one examines the historical proof intelligently, it’s not onerous to discover that the consumption of tea acquired began in China. Tea itself is a native to southern China. So as to appreciate the methods in which tea ingesting can turn your Asian residence or workplace into a ravishing place, it’s essential to discover the unique follow carefully. Tea consuming may have gotten its start in China but is was by no means restricted to that region. Tea has been a significant a part of the expertise of many Asian cultures since then.

In Tang occasions (618-906 CE) tea turned a national drink with an established custom in Buddhist monasteries. The thought was to forestall drowsiness within the monks throughout their instances of lengthy meditation. In terms of archeology, tea has been discovered buried in a number of tombs with the dead. It was thought of a “good” of the Han dynasty (206-220 CE) in the afterlife. There may be additionally sturdy evidence which means that tea drinking started in China even before the time of Christ.

It was through the Three Kingdoms period (220-265 CE) Zhang Yi detailed in his book the specifics of tea production. The description was largely associated to the way in which tea was produced in both Sichuan and Hubei provinces. This included the processing of tea leaves into tea cakes. The poet Lu Tung (795-835 CE) wrote the Song of Tea. The tune proclaimed the superior benefit of tea drinking. It was additionally about this same time Lu Yu (760-800 CE), the best authority on tea, wrote “Chajin” (The Traditional of Tea). Ever since its debut, this writing has persistently remained the single most authoritative manual for tea consumers. It likewise describes the instruments required to reap leaves and process tea. In addition, the utensils to brew tea and an inventory of tea producing areas together with their respective gradings are included.

So how did China affect different Asian cultures to adopt tea drinking? Japanese monks Kubai (774-835 CE) and Saicho (767-822 CE) took a journey to China in 804. Their assumed goal was to study Chan or “Zen” Buddhism. This might take place in Tianmushan, Zhejiang province. Nonetheless, this particular locality was very talked-about for tea manufacturing as well. Due to this fact, when the monks returned to Japan not too long after their go to they began tea plantation in their homeland. They introduced obligatory tea seeds with them back from China to do this. Naturally, this was in addition to introducing the Japanese folks to Zen Buddhism.

Throughout the early Heian interval (794-1185 CE), Japanese literati adopted the custom of tea ingesting from Tang China. The Japanese started to drink tea throughout social gatherings. Typically, these social gatherings were accompanied by activities loved by the educated and cultured members of society. These activities usually included such things as composing, reciting poetry, and enjoying music. It is simple to know how tea ingesting would thrive in this type of social atmosphere. To make the purpose clear, it’s apparent that China’s tea ingesting and manufacturing of tea leaves gained affect in a lot of East Asia a very long time ago. It is nearly like a social glue which permeates your complete region today.
